Best Internet Providers in Sunderland, MD
Xfinity is the top-rated provider in Sunderland, Maryland, offering cable connections starting at $40 per month. Xfinity delivers reliable service to 95.5% of the city with downloads up to 2 Gbps. While XNET WiFi provides similar top speeds, XNET WiFi starts at a higher entry point of $65 per month.

Sunderland Cheapest Internet Plans
Mint Mobile offers the lowest starting rates in Sunderland, Maryland at $30 per month. Using 5G technology, Mint Mobile covers 77.7% of the area with speeds up to 415 Mbps. Hughesnet serves as an alternative for budget seekers, though Hughesnet starts at $39.99 per month for satellite connectivity.

Fastest Internet Providers in Sunderland, MD
Xfinity delivers the most responsive performance in Sunderland, Maryland with downloads reaching up to 2 Gbps. Xfinity also provides significant upload capacity up to 200 Mbps across 95.5% of the city. XNET WiFi matches the peak download speed, but XNET WiFi offers lower upload speeds up to 20 Mbps per month.

Internet Availability in Sunderland, MD
Xfinity maintains the widest high-speed footprint in Sunderland, Maryland, reaching 95.5% of the area. Xfinity cable plans begin at $40 per month with downloads up to 2 Gbps. For residents in remote pockets, Starlink provides satellite coverage to 100.0% of the city with rates starting at $55 per month.
| Connection type | Provider with most coverage | Sunderland availability | Starting price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Satellite | Hughesnet | 100% | $39.99/mo |
| Cable | Xfinity | 95.5% | $40/mo |
| 5G Internet | Mint Mobile | 77.7% | $30/mo |
| Fixed Wireless | XNET WiFi | 76.8% | $65/mo |

Methodology
Our provider rankings rely on a rigorous, data-driven framework evaluating over 100 million rows of FCC data to bring transparency to local internet options. We track 8,000+ active plans from 2,000+ providers to cut through marketing jargon. We weigh technical factors against real-world experiences to match you with the best connections actually available at your address:
- Tested Technology: We utilize a fiber-first ranking system, prioritizing high-performance, structurally sound technologies (like fiber and cable) over slower legacy connections.
- Realistic Coverage: We filter out "ghost ISPs" with near-zero availability and actively flag providers that only cover a fraction of neighborhoods, ensuring you don't waste time on unavailable options.
- Transparent Pricing: We track base rates and downgrade providers that rely on hidden fees or sudden price hikes, exposing the true long-term cost beyond initial marketing promotions.
- Verified Speeds: We look beyond deceptive "up to" marketing claims to evaluate the actual download and upload speeds delivered, prioritizing the balanced, symmetrical performance necessary for seamless video calls and heavy streaming.
- User-Driven Personalization: We don't just look at the tech; we look at what people actually prefer. By analyzing millions of local connections, user reviews on downtime, and validated J.D. Power scores, we tailor our rankings to highlight the providers proven to satisfy users in your area.
